Description

(3-Trifluoromethyl-Benzyl)-Hydrazine is a specialized aromatic hydrazine derivative featuring a benzyl group substituted with a trifluoromethyl moiety. This compound matters as a versatile and high-value building block in advanced organic synthesis, where its unique structure enables the introduction of both hydrazine and fluorinated aromatic functionalities. It is primarily needed by research and development chemists in the pharmaceutical and agrochemical industries for creating novel active ingredients, particularly in medicinal chemistry for lead optimization and scaffold diversification.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of heterocyclic compounds, such as pyrazoles and indazoles, for drug discovery programs targeting CNS disorders, oncology, and metabolic diseases.
  • Agrochemical Synthesis: Used in the development of novel herbicides, fungicides, and insecticides, where the trifluoromethyl group enhances biological activity and environmental stability.
  • Ligand and Catalyst Development: Serves as a starting material for creating specialized chelating ligands and organocatalysts used in asymmetric synthesis.
  • Material Science Research: Employed in the synthesis of fluorinated polymers and advanced organic materials with tailored surface properties.
  • Chemical Biology Probes: Utilized to create hydrazone-based linkers and fluorinated tags for labeling and studying biomolecules.

Basic Information

Product Name (3-Trifluoromethyl-Benzyl)-Hydrazine
CAS No. 51421-34-2
Molecular Formula C8H9F3N2
Molecular Weight 190.17 g/mol
Synonyms 1-[(3-Trifluoromethyl)phenyl]methylhydrazine; 1-(3-Trifluoromethylbenzyl)hydrazine; m-Trifluoromethylbenzylhydrazine; (3-(Trifluoromethyl)benzyl)hydrazine; α-Hydrazino-α-(trifluoromethyl)toluene; 3-Trifluoromethylbenzyl Hydrazine; (m-Trifluoromethylbenzyl)hydrazine; Hydrazine, [(3-(trifluoromethyl)phenyl)methyl]-

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ic and easily oxidized nature, it is recommended to store the product under an inert atmosphere (e.g., nitrogen or argon) for long-term preservation and to minimize degradation. Keep away from strong oxidizing agents.
